Machine Learning Transforms Indian Media: A Comprehensive Dive

The rapid development of machine learning is profoundly altering the Bharat’s journalism sector. From automated content creation to better fact-checking and tailored information delivery, artificial intelligence platforms are widely being utilized by local news organizations. This change presents both possibilities – such as greater efficiency and wider reach – and challenges, like concerns about employment reduction and the risk for unintended error. A vital assessment of these developments is essential to maintain a fair and trustworthy media environment for Bharat.

India's Expanding Television Channels: A New Rise

Over the previous few periods, India has witnessed a remarkable boom in the number of media channels. This growth isn't just about more channels; it reflects a shift in viewing habits and increasing demand for specific content. Several factors are driving this trend, including improved digital infrastructure, lower costs of equipment, and a want for diverse perspectives. Audiences now have access to a greater range of channels focusing on various things from national politics to grassroots events. This phenomenon is reshaping the environment of Indian media, creating both chances and challenges for existing players and new entrants equally.
